>> I am collecting some resources (beginner level) in order to start using Virtuoso (OpenSource Edition) for a project I am working with.
I would like to use it both for hosting triples and for its sponger (CSV to RDF)
I sincerely never used it, but I would like to give it try. Do you have some recommendations, like nice books or tutorial (even video) about it? >>

I have used Virtuoso for some exploratory triple store research. It was relatively easy to install on both PC as well as Unix/Unix-like systems. There should be some pre-compiled installs available online. My one work of caution about Virtuoso is that is has a lot of bells an whistles. This is not a huge problem if you are just using it for basic triple store use but it does have the potential to lead to an Oracle like scenario where you build applications and services around the infrastructure and then find yourself unable to easily migrate them into another triple store environment. That being said, Virtuoso is by far the easiest triple store to manage, it has a very nice web-based user interface.

If you want to test out a bare-bones triple store, I would suggest 4Store (http://4store.org/). It has pre-compiled installs for Unix and Unix-like systems (although not Windows). It supports SPARQL 1.1 and is relatively easy to tweak/configure.

You can also use Pubby (http://wifo5-03.informatik.uni-mannheim.de/pubby/) as a front-end user interface for viewing entities on the Web. DbPedia uses Pubby as the front-end for their Virtuoso triple store. 

I have used a 4Store and Pubby infrastructure for quite a few projects and would be happy to help out with any questions. Since Pubby is relatively universal, I could also help out with any Virtuoso/Pubby questions.
